The Latest Stats on Women-owned Businesses
February 26, 2008In recognition of National Women’s History Month (March), the U.S. Census has just released some interesting statistics on women in the U.S.
Unfortunately, the latest numbers the Census has on women-owned businesses date back to 2002 when there were 6.5 million women-owned businesses generating more than $939 billion in revenue and employing more than 7.1 million people. Most women-owned businesses are small businesses, with only 7,231 having more than 100 employees. California had the highest percentage of women-owned firms – 13 percent followed by New York at 8 percent and Texas at 7 percent.
